The C10 fuse box has those square style holes on the left side and lower area, I am looking for an adapter plug to go into those to tap into the power and add a circuit - just a plug with a wire out of it basically, I've seen these before and know they exist but can't find them online, does anyone know the name of that style add-a-fuse/circuit style adapter?
https://www.americanautowire.com/sho...t-ato-fuse-box

The style is called ATO... each section actually has a particular design (ACC doesn't fit in one space to the right for instance), or at least that's what I've been told. They look very similar when just looking at them, but apparently the adapter you would use for ACC and the one you would use for IGN are different in shape, so thus you would use the RED over the Clear, etc. One option, if you are looking to be quick and dirty, is to use a spade terminal and stick it into the spot you are working on. In fact, I would recommend that before splicing in one of these terminals, to keep you from wasting them!
